如何使代码格式化标准在netbeans和eclipse中相等。此外,我在netbeans中使用eclipse代码格式化程序的任何方式都是因为netbeans不格式化javadocs注释
Abdul Khaliq
也许吧。您有以下选项:
-
将格式化程序配置为最低公分母(即两者都可以做的事情)。不确定这是否可能,因为你无法"关闭"某些选项。
-
Eclipse有一个名为"清理"的特性。选择项目,它将在"源"菜单中可用。这允许您清理项目的某些方面:未使用的导入、格式化等。因此,您可以将工作保存在Netbeans中,然后在Eclipse中偶尔清理一次项目。
-
使用像Jindent这样的外部格式化程序(商业,但他们有非商业许可证)。创建一个Ant任务来格式化代码。
如果你的项目使用Maven,你可以使用这个Maven插件:http://code.google.com/p/maven-java-formatter-plugin/
它使用Eclipse格式化类来进行格式化,并且可以使用Eclipse格式化首选项进行配置,请参阅此处的configFile
属性:http://maven-java-formatter-plugin.googlecode.com/svn/site/0.3.1/format-mojo.html